رفتن به مطلب

اضافه کردن فیلد شماره موبایل مشتری درقسمت آدرس ها (بخش مدیریت)


پست های پیشنهاد شده

امروز میخوام براتون یه آموزش کاربردی رو شرح بدم که شاید دغدغه خیلی از افرادیست که با پرستاشاپ کار میکنند . :cool:

 

خوب شما اگه بخواین واسه یه مشتری پیامک ارسال کنید یا تماس تلفنی بگیرید ، شماره تلفن مشتری رو از کجا بدست میارید؟؟!!

خوب برای اینکه شماره تلفن یک مشتری رو بدونید باید برید تو مدیریت / مشتری ها و روی یک مشتری کلیک کنید و بعدش تو وسطای صفحه تلفن مشتری رو پیدا میکنید . تازه اگه به شماره موبایل مشتری نیاز داشته باشید باید روی مشاهده آدرس هم کلیک کنید تا بتونید شماره موبایل یک مشتری رو بدست ببینید . :D

 

حالا فرض کنید شما بخواین واسه 10 مشتری پیامک به صورت دستی ارسال کنید باید این همه صفحه رو زیر و رو کنید تا موبایل هر کدوم رو ببینید . :(

 

در این آموزش من میخوام با یک مرحله ساده به شما آموزش بدم تا شماره موبایل مشتری رو به زیر منوی آدرس ها اضافه کنید تا وقتی لازم شد به راحتی شماره موبایل مشتری در دسترستون باشه .

 

 

خوب برای شروع فایل AdminAddresses.php رو از پوشه admin و پوشه tabs پیدا کنید .

من برای راحتی کار شما کد ها رو میذارم تا جایگزین کنید. :)

تو این فایل تو سطرهای اول دنبال این عبارات بگردید :

 

$this->fieldsDisplay = array(
	'id_address' => array('title' => $this->l('ID'), 'align' => 'center', 'width' => 25),
	'firstname' => array('title' => $this->l('First name'), 'width' => 80, 'filter_key' => 'a!firstname'),
	'lastname' => array('title' => $this->l('Last name'), 'width' => 100, 'filter_key' => 'a!lastname'),
	'address1' => array('title' => $this->l('Address'), 'width' => 200),
	'postcode' => array('title' => $this->l('Postcode/ Zip Code'), 'align' => 'right', 'width' => 50),
	'city' => array('title' => $this->l('City'), 'width' => 150),
	'country' => array('title' => $this->l('Country'), 'width' => 100, 'type' => 'select', 'select' => $this->countriesArray, 'filter_key' => 'cl!id_country'));

 

و با این عبارات جایگزین کنید

	$this->fieldsDisplay = array(
	'id_address' => array('title' => $this->l('ID'), 'align' => 'center', 'width' => 25),
	'firstname' => array('title' => $this->l('First name'), 'width' => 80, 'filter_key' => 'a!firstname'),
	'lastname' => array('title' => $this->l('Last name'), 'width' => 100, 'filter_key' => 'a!lastname'),
	'address1' => array('title' => $this->l('Address'), 'width' => 200),
	'postcode' => array('title' => $this->l('Postcode/ Zip Code'), 'align' => 'right', 'width' => 50),
	'phone_mobile' => array('title' => $this->l('phone_mobile'), 'width' => 100),
           	'city' => array('title' => $this->l('city'), 'width' => 100),
	'Country' => array('title' => $this->l('Country'), 'width' => 100, 'type' => 'select', 'select' => $this->countriesArray, 'filter_key' => 'cl!id_country'));

 

خوب مرحله بعد چیه به نظرتون ؟؟؟!!

 

مرحله بعدی دیگه در کار نیست و الان شما از قسمت مشتریان / آدرس ها میتونید شماره موبایل مشتری رو هم به همراه آدرس ایمیل داشته باشید و لذت ببرید. منتظر آموزش های کاربردی دیگه تو بخش مدیریت باشید ;)

 

لینک به دیدگاه
به اشتراک گذاری در سایت های دیگر

خيلي ممنون عزيز

به اميد اموزش هاي بيشترت :heart:

عزيز يه عكس مي توني بزاري دقيق بگي كجا

چون من توي 1.3 به طور پيش فرض و بدون تغييري شماره موبايل و شماره تلفن مشتري رو مي بينم در اونجا

مدیریت / مشتری ها و روی یک مشتری کلیک کنید

 

لینک به دیدگاه
به اشتراک گذاری در سایت های دیگر

خيلي ممنون عزيز

به اميد اموزش هاي بيشترت :heart:

عزيز يه عكس مي توني بزاري دقيق بگي كجا

چون من توي 1.3 به طور پيش فرض و بدون تغييري شماره موبايل و شماره تلفن مشتري رو مي بينم در اونجا

مدیریت / مشتری ها و روی یک مشتری کلیک کنید

 

من این آموزش رو برای پرستاشاپ 1.4 به بالا قرار دادم و نمیدونم تو 1.3 چه شکلی هستش . تو 1.4 وقتی از منو روی مشتری ها کلیک میکنی و مشتری ها رو لیست میکنه تو لیست شماره موبایل مشتری یا شماره تلفن وجود نداره . همنین تو آدرسها که آدرسها رو لیست میکنه باز نه تلفن وجود داره نه موبایل که من موبایل رو با این آموزش به قسمت آدرس ها اضافه کردم :D

 

 

لینک به دیدگاه
به اشتراک گذاری در سایت های دیگر

  • 3 weeks later...

خيلي ممنون عزيز

به اميد اموزش هاي بيشترت :heart:

عزيز يه عكس مي توني بزاري دقيق بگي كجا

چون من توي 1.3 به طور پيش فرض و بدون تغييري شماره موبايل و شماره تلفن مشتري رو مي بينم در اونجا

مدیریت / مشتری ها و روی یک مشتری کلیک کنید

 

شروین جان همونطور که خودت گفتی باید روی مشتری کلیک کنی. با این آموزشی که بهمن جان زحمت کشیدن دیگه نیازی به کلیک کردن نیست و در همون لیست میتونی شماره رو ببینی
لینک به دیدگاه
به اشتراک گذاری در سایت های دیگر

  • 2 months later...

در نسخه 1.3.1 هم کار میکنه من بعد از خط کدپستی این خط رو اضافه کردم

 

'phone_mobile' => array('title' => $this->l('phone_mobile'), 'align' => 'right', 'width' => 80),

 

و شماره موبایل نمایش داده میشه

 

لینک به دیدگاه
به اشتراک گذاری در سایت های دیگر

  • 2 months later...

با سلام

این روشی که شما فرمودین برای فرم دریافت اطلاعات مشتری بدون ثبت نام در نسخه 1.4 مطابق با دستور انجام دادم منتهی جواب نداد

 

هیچگونه فیلد جدیدی در فرم خرید فوری اضافه نشد

علت چیست؟

 

لینک به دیدگاه
به اشتراک گذاری در سایت های دیگر

  • 1 year later...
  • 2 months later...

ببخشید میشه این آموزش هم برای ورژن 1.5 بزارید فایل AdminAddresses.php تو ورژن 1.5 نیست

با سلام ،

برای اینکه بتونین از این آموزش در نسخه 1.5X استفاده کنین باید دنبال فایل زیر باشین :

AdminAddressesController.php که در آدرس : controllers\admin وجود داره . بعد طبق روش توضیح داده شده توسط آقا بهمن فیلد مربوط به موبایل رو اضافه کنین ، همین !

لینک به دیدگاه
به اشتراک گذاری در سایت های دیگر

  • 1 year later...
  • 11 months later...

با سلام و تشکر از آموزش مفیدی که قرار دادین.

سوالم این هست که اگر بخوایم عنوان استان رو هم به این لیست اضافه کنیم، چه کد یا متنی رو باید وارد کنیم؟؟؟

لینک به دیدگاه
به اشتراک گذاری در سایت های دیگر

به گفتگو بپیوندید

هم اکنون می توانید مطلب خود را ارسال نمایید و بعداً ثبت نام کنید. اگر حساب کاربری دارید، برای ارسال با حساب کاربری خود اکنون وارد شوید .

مهمان
ارسال پاسخ به این موضوع ...

×   شما در حال چسباندن محتوایی با قالب بندی هستید.   حذف قالب بندی

  تنها استفاده از 75 اموجی مجاز می باشد.

×   لینک شما به صورت اتوماتیک جای گذاری شد.   نمایش به صورت لینک

×   محتوای قبلی شما بازگردانی شد.   پاک کردن محتوای ویرایشگر

×   شما مستقیما نمی توانید تصویر خود را قرار دهید. یا آن را اینجا بارگذاری کنید یا از یک URL قرار دهید.

در حال بارگذاری


  • کاربران آنلاین در این صفحه

    هیچ کاربر عضوی،در حال مشاهده این صفحه نیست.

×
×
  • اضافه کردن...